ANNAPOLIS, Md. – The Navy offshore sailing team had two crews competing at the Shipyard Cup Regatta in Boothbay Harbor, Maine this past weekend, taking first and fifth in their class.
Â
Sailing in a variety of challenging conditions over the weekend, the Mids continually tested their skills including racing through dense fog.
Â
Senior skipper Javier Jimenez-Kane led his crew aboard KODIAK to first place out of eight boats in Performance Division 1 over the four-race series. Kane's crew included senior XO
Kit Oney, seniors
Cam Coffelt and
Casey Quijano, juniors Chris Cordner,
Ulysses Buzan, Gus Reed, Inaku Romero-Garza and Finn Prescott and sophomores Chad Schaffner, Sean Cain, Olivia Schuchard, Zach Peterson, Ed Konjoyan and Graham Rose.
Â
Fellow senior skipper Maddy Ploch led her crew to fifth place in the same class aboard WAHOO, as the second Navy crew had a strong regatta going until they suffered a sail failure just before the final race, causing them to miss the race and take a last place score.
Â
The crews departed Boothbay on Sunday evening bound for Sea Cliff, N.Y., where the Mids will compete in the Around Long Island Race starting Thursday.
